内容简介:本项目为Flutter中文网《Flutter实战》开源电子书项目,官网地址为:本书目前仍在创作中,如果您想参与到本书创作,欢迎提PR。本书目录结构如下:为了后续图片能够容易上CDN,如果您需要在文档中引入新的图片,请按如下步骤操作:
简介
本项目为Flutter中文网《Flutter实战》开源电子书项目,官网地址为: https://book.flutterchina.club .
贡献须知
本书目前仍在创作中,如果您想参与到本书创作,欢迎提PR。本书目录结构如下:
目录及文件 | 说明 |
---|---|
docs | 文档目录,您应该在此目录下对应的章节文件夹下修改/创建Markdown文档 |
_book | 打包后的网站代码目录,您不应该手动修改此目录下的文档 |
docs/SUMMARY.md | 本书目录,要修改目录请参考本文档中前面章节。 |
docs/imgs | 本书所引的图片、截图目录 |
图片引入说明
为了后续图片能够容易上CDN,如果您需要在文档中引入新的图片,请按如下步骤操作:
-
将您的图片大小进行调整,有一个要求是图片高度最大不能超过500像素,原则上单张图片最大不能超过300K.
-
将图片拷贝到docs/imgs目录,注意不要重名
-
在你的文章中用 相对路径 引用,如:
![](../imgs/xx.jpg)
当您提交内容被合入后,我们会来上传CDN,自动替换图片链接,然后回提到仓库中,在您下次提交之前,您需要先pull一下变更。
构建环境搭建
本书是采用gitbook编写,要想在本地运行网站,需要安装一下环境:
-
安装node;如果已经安装过node,可以省略这一步。node安装方法自行百度。
-
安装gitbook。
npm i -g gitbook gitbook-cli
-
本地进入到本项目根目录,运行:
gitbook install #安装本书构建所要依赖的插件
-
运行网站,可以编辑了~
gitbook serve
哪些章节还没有写?
本书目前未完成部分在官网目录中会置灰,他们会统一链接到一个todo页面,您应该首先来写这一部分主题。如果您有新的章节想补充,请先联系我!沟通后如果觉得有必要方可添加。
提交更新
为了保证书籍质量,提交后的内容都需要Review,所以您PR提交之后离正式合入可能会需要多次修改,为了节省时间,请在提交PR后的第一时间通知我Review。
勘误
如果您发现本书的错误,欢迎PR。
联系方式
微信号:Demons-du
免费?
知识是应该付费的,创作不易,开源不等于免费,如果您是本书读者并手头宽裕,可以微信扫描下面二维码打赏,也不用太多,够买一杯咖啡就行。当然,如果您囊中羞涩,您也可以阅读本书,但我对您有个小小的要求,希望您在阅读的过程中能积极参与到本书的纠错以及未完成内容的创作上来,也算是有所付出。
以上所述就是小编给大家介绍的《《Flutter 实战》开源电子书》,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对 码农网 的支持!
猜你喜欢:- 开始一本开源电子书《Kubernetes指南》
- 开源电子书项目FBReader初探(一)
- 开源电子书项目FBReader初探(二)
- 开源电子书项目FBReader初探(三)
- 开源电子书项目FBReader初探(四)
- 开源电子书项目FBReader初探(五)
本站部分资源来源于网络,本站转载出于传递更多信息之目的,版权归原作者或者来源机构所有,如转载稿涉及版权问题,请联系我们。
Java Concurrency in Practice
Brian Goetz、Tim Peierls、Joshua Bloch、Joseph Bowbeer、David Holmes、Doug Lea / Addison-Wesley Professional / 2006-5-19 / USD 59.99
This book covers: Basic concepts of concurrency and thread safety Techniques for building and composing thread-safe classes Using the concurrency building blocks in java.util.concurrent Pe......一起来看看 《Java Concurrency in Practice》 这本书的介绍吧!